Grow the key to authentic salsa verde with our Purple Tomatillo seeds. This beautiful heirloom is celebrated for its tart, tangy, and citrusy flavor, which is the essential ingredient for many classic Mexican dishes. The small, globe-shaped fruits ripen to a deep purple and are encased in a papery husk. The productive, sprawling plants will provide a bountiful harvest perfect for making salsa, sauces, or for grilling and roasting.

🌱 Growing instructions

  • Sowing: Start seeds indoors 4-6 weeks before the last frost.
  • Depth: Plant seeds 1/4 inch deep in a moist, well-draining seed starting mix.
  • Germination: Keep soil very warm (75-85°F). Germination takes 7-14 days.
  • Spacing: Harden off seedlings and transplant outdoors after all danger of frost, spacing them 2-3 feet apart.
  • Pollination: You must plant at least two tomatillo plants for them to pollinate each other and produce fruit.
  • Support: Provide stakes or cages to support the sprawling plants.
